数据可视化系统如何实现交互式操作?

在当今信息爆炸的时代,数据可视化系统已成为企业、政府及科研机构进行数据分析和决策的重要工具。然而,如何实现数据可视化系统的交互式操作,让用户在享受丰富数据展示的同时,也能高效地进行数据交互和探索,成为了一个关键问题。本文将深入探讨数据可视化系统如何实现交互式操作,并分析其背后的技术原理和应用案例。

一、数据可视化系统交互式操作的重要性

数据可视化系统交互式操作的重要性体现在以下几个方面:

  1. 提高用户操作体验:通过交互式操作,用户可以更加直观地了解数据,从而提高操作体验。

  2. 加速数据分析过程:交互式操作可以帮助用户快速定位数据,提高数据分析效率。

  3. 促进数据探索:交互式操作使得用户可以自由地探索数据,挖掘潜在价值。

  4. 提升决策质量:通过交互式操作,用户可以更加全面地了解数据,从而做出更加科学的决策。

二、数据可视化系统交互式操作的技术原理

  1. 事件驱动:数据可视化系统交互式操作的核心是事件驱动。当用户进行某种操作时,系统会触发相应的事件,进而执行相应的处理逻辑。

  2. 动态更新:交互式操作要求系统实时更新数据展示,以反映用户操作的结果。

  3. 用户界面(UI)设计:良好的UI设计可以提升用户操作体验,降低学习成本。

  4. 数据处理能力:数据可视化系统需要具备强大的数据处理能力,以满足用户对交互式操作的需求。

三、数据可视化系统交互式操作的关键技术

  1. 拖拽操作:用户可以通过拖拽的方式选择数据,实现数据的筛选、排序等操作。

  2. 缩放和平移:用户可以通过缩放和平移操作,查看数据的不同细节。

  3. 动态过滤:用户可以通过动态过滤,筛选出符合特定条件的数据。

  4. 链接和跳转:用户可以通过链接和跳转操作,快速切换到相关数据页面。

  5. 动态提示:系统可以根据用户操作,提供动态提示,帮助用户更好地理解数据。

四、数据可视化系统交互式操作的应用案例

  1. 企业级数据可视化平台:以某企业级数据可视化平台为例,该平台通过拖拽操作、动态过滤等技术,实现了用户对数据的交互式操作。用户可以根据需求,快速筛选、排序和展示数据,从而提高数据分析效率。

  2. 政府大数据可视化系统:某政府大数据可视化系统采用交互式操作,帮助政府部门对海量数据进行实时监控和分析。通过动态更新、动态提示等技术,系统为政府决策提供了有力支持。

  3. 科研机构数据可视化平台:某科研机构数据可视化平台通过交互式操作,实现了对科研数据的深度挖掘。用户可以自由探索数据,挖掘潜在规律,为科研工作提供有益参考。

五、总结

数据可视化系统交互式操作在提高用户操作体验、加速数据分析过程、促进数据探索和提升决策质量等方面具有重要意义。通过事件驱动、动态更新、用户界面设计等关键技术,数据可视化系统可以实现高效的交互式操作。在实际应用中,企业、政府及科研机构可以根据自身需求,选择合适的技术和方案,实现数据可视化系统的交互式操作。

猜你喜欢:全栈链路追踪